zoukankan      html  css  js  c++  java
  • Mysql查询数据(单表查询)

    一、查询所有字段

    1,SELECT 字段1,字段2,字段3...FROM 表名;

    2,SELECT * FROM 表名;

    二、查询指定字段

    1,SELECT 字段1,字段2,字段3...FROM 表名;

    三、Where 条件查询

    1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 条件表达式;

    四、带IN 关键字查询

    1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段[NOT] IN (元素1,元素2,元素3);

    五、带BETWEEN AND 的范围查询

    1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段[NOT] BETWEEN 取值1 AND 取值2;

    六、带LIKE 的模糊查询

    1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段[NOT] LIKE ‘字符串’;

    “%”代表任意字符;

    “_” 代表单个字符;

    七、空值查询

    1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段IS [NOT] NULL;

    八、带AND 的多条件查询

    1,SELECT 字段1,字段2...FROM 表名WHERE 条件表达式1 AND 条件表达式2 [...AND 条件表达式n]

    九、带OR 的多条件查询

    1,SELECT 字段1,字段2...FROM 表名WHERE 条件表达式1 OR 条件表达式2 [...OR 条件表达式n]

    十、DISTINCT 去重复查询

    SELECT DISTINCT 字段名FROM 表名;

    1.1.11对查询结果排序

    SELECT 字段1,字段2...FROM 表名ORDER BY 属性名[ASC|DESC]

    1.1.12GROUP BY 分组查询

    GROUP BY 属性名[HAVING 条件表达式][WITH ROLLUP]

    1,单独使用(毫无意义);

    2,与GROUP_CONCAT()函数一起使用;

    3,与聚合函数一起使用;

    4,与HAVING 一起使用(限制输出的结果);

    5,与WITH ROLLUP 一起使用(最后加入一个总和行);

    1.1.13LIMIT 分页查询

    SELECT 字段1,字段2...FROM 表名LIMIT 初始位置,记录数;

    1.1.1查询所有字段1,SELECT 字段1,字段2,字段3...FROM 表名;2,SELECT * FROM 表名;1.1.2查询指定字段1,SELECT 字段1,字段2,字段3...FROM 表名;1.1.3Where 条件查询1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 条件表达式;1.1.4带IN 关键字查询1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段[NOT] IN (元素1,元素2,元素3);1.1.5带BETWEEN AND 的范围查询1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段[NOT] BETWEEN 取值1 AND 取值2;1.1.6带LIKE 的模糊查询1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段[NOT] LIKE ‘字符串’;“%”代表任意字符;“_” 代表单个字符;1.1.7空值查询1,SELECT 字段1,字段2,字段3...FROM 表名WHERE 字段IS [NOT] NULL;1.1.8带AND 的多条件查询1,SELECT 字段1,字段2...FROM 表名WHERE 条件表达式1 AND 条件表达式2 [...AND 条件表达式n]1.1.9带OR 的多条件查询1,SELECT 字段1,字段2...FROM 表名WHERE 条件表达式1 OR 条件表达式2 [...OR 条件表达式n]1.1.10DISTINCT 去重复查询SELECT DISTINCT 字段名FROM 表名;1.1.11对查询结果排序SELECT 字段1,字段2...FROM 表名ORDER BY 属性名[ASC|DESC]1.1.12GROUP BY 分组查询GROUP BY 属性名[HAVING 条件表达式][WITH ROLLUP]1,单独使用(毫无意义);2,与GROUP_CONCAT()函数一起使用;3,与聚合函数一起使用;4,与HAVING 一起使用(限制输出的结果);5,与WITH ROLLUP 一起使用(最后加入一个总和行);1.1.13LIMIT 分页查询SELECT 字段1,字段2...FROM 表名LIMIT 初始位置,记录数;

  • 相关阅读:
    转:SQL Server 2005 Express附加数据库为“只读”的解决方法!
    通过WPF模拟交通红绿灯(图文教程)
    手把手教你怎样把文件保存到Oracle数据库
    已删除
    JavaScript精炼类(class)、构造函数(constructor)、原型(prototype)
    Ext:RowLayout和ColumnLayout连用必须加panel的问题
    Ext:前台js往gridpanel动态添加记录
    "int i=1" "int i=new int() "和“String str = "a";” “String str = new String("a")”区别以及c#值类型和引用类型
    未能加载文件或程序集“Model Version=1.0.0.0, Culture=neutral, PublicKeyToken=null”或它的某一个依赖项。系统找不到指定的文件。
    hibernate:inverse、cascade,一对多、多对多详解
  • 原文地址:https://www.cnblogs.com/FrankLiner/p/8036046.html
Copyright © 2011-2022 走看看